The cheapest way to get from Naperville to Lincoln Park is to train which costs $5 - $6 and takes 1h 4m.
The fastest way to get from Naperville to Lincoln Park is to drive which takes 40 min and costs $5 - $9.
No, there is no direct bus from Naperville to Lincoln Park. However, there are services departing from Naperville and arriving at Webster & Orchard via Clinton Blue Line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 35m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Naperville and arriving at Chicago Union Station station.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 4m.
The distance between Naperville and Lincoln Park is 28 miles. The road distance is 31.7 miles.
The best way to get from Naperville to Lincoln Park without a car is to train which takes 1h 4m and costs $5 - $6.
